Poland was considered to come back twice (in 1990 and 2004) but didn't "look the part" i.e. he looks like a college professor teaching liberal arts classes, not a rock star.
I like Gar but Menza was a much better fit for the RiP material than Gar would've been. He's just not a hard-hitting drummer as much as I love the first 2 MD albums.
Portnoy is never coming back to DT because he is such a pain to deal with. The musical ideas he tried to push didn't make the band better. But he did join Overkill live once so he's probably up for a good paying thrash gig.
Lombardo has been considered/auditioned twice for the band and I think now the stars could align and he could join. He is very outspoken in interviews too so that is probably why he won't last long (if they don't fight over money first). Ellefson is more diplomatic and that is probably one reason he stayed so long.
